Common questions
How many calories are in Chili Stir In Noodles?
Chili Stir In Noodles by Kabuto Noodles has 356 kcal per 100 g. One serving (90 g) is about 320 kcal.
How much protein is in Chili Stir In Noodles?
Chili Stir In Noodles contains 12.2 g of protein per 100 g — about 11 g per 90 g serving.
Is Chili Stir In Noodles a good source of protein?
Yes — 12.2 g of protein per 100 g, supplying 14% of its calories. That makes it a good protein source.
Is Chili Stir In Noodles high in sodium?
Yes — 961.1 mg of sodium per 100 g, about 42% of the daily value.
Is Chili Stir In Noodles a good source of fiber?
It provides 5.3 g of fiber per 100 g — 19% of the daily value, making it a high-fiber food.
Why does Chili Stir In Noodles have a Nutri-Score of C?
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from calorie density (356 kcal), sugar (12.2 g), sodium (961.1 mg); points in favor come from fiber (5.3 g), protein (12.2 g). Overall that places it in band C.
How much Chili Stir In Noodles is 100 calories?
About 28 g of Chili Stir In Noodles equals 100 kcal. It is energy-dense, so small amounts add up quickly.
Is Chili Stir In Noodles high in calories?
Yes — 356 kcal per 100 g makes it calorie-dense; a 50 g portion is already about 178 kcal.
